Update angular to 19
This commit is contained in:
32
package.json
32
package.json
@@ -11,19 +11,19 @@
|
||||
},
|
||||
"private": true,
|
||||
"dependencies": {
|
||||
"@angular/animations": "^18.2.5",
|
||||
"@angular/animations": "^19.2.14",
|
||||
"@angular/cdk": "^18.2.5",
|
||||
"@angular/common": "^18.2.5",
|
||||
"@angular/compiler": "^18.2.5",
|
||||
"@angular/core": "^18.2.5",
|
||||
"@angular/forms": "^18.2.5",
|
||||
"@angular/common": "^19.2.14",
|
||||
"@angular/compiler": "^19.2.14",
|
||||
"@angular/core": "^19.2.14",
|
||||
"@angular/forms": "^19.2.14",
|
||||
"@angular/material": "^18.2.5",
|
||||
"@angular/material-moment-adapter": "^18.2.5",
|
||||
"@angular/platform-browser": "^18.2.5",
|
||||
"@angular/platform-browser-dynamic": "^18.2.5",
|
||||
"@angular/platform-server": "^18.2.5",
|
||||
"@angular/router": "^18.2.5",
|
||||
"@angular/ssr": "^18.2.5",
|
||||
"@angular/platform-browser": "^19.2.14",
|
||||
"@angular/platform-browser-dynamic": "^19.2.14",
|
||||
"@angular/platform-server": "^19.2.14",
|
||||
"@angular/router": "^19.2.14",
|
||||
"@angular/ssr": "^19.2.15",
|
||||
"@ng-bootstrap/ng-bootstrap": "^17.0.0",
|
||||
"@popperjs/core": "^2.11.8",
|
||||
"bootstrap": "^5.3.2",
|
||||
@@ -34,13 +34,13 @@
|
||||
"rxjs": "~7.8.0",
|
||||
"ts-enums": "^0.0.6",
|
||||
"tslib": "^2.3.0",
|
||||
"zone.js": "~0.14.10"
|
||||
"zone.js": "~0.15.1"
|
||||
},
|
||||
"devDependencies": {
|
||||
"@angular-devkit/build-angular": "^18.2.5",
|
||||
"@angular/cli": "^18.2.5",
|
||||
"@angular/compiler-cli": "^18.2.5",
|
||||
"@angular/localize": "^18.2.5",
|
||||
"@angular-devkit/build-angular": "^19.2.15",
|
||||
"@angular/cli": "^19.2.15",
|
||||
"@angular/compiler-cli": "^19.2.14",
|
||||
"@angular/localize": "^19.2.14",
|
||||
"@types/express": "^4.17.17",
|
||||
"@types/jasmine": "~5.1.0",
|
||||
"@types/node": "^18.18.0",
|
||||
@@ -50,6 +50,6 @@
|
||||
"karma-coverage": "~2.2.0",
|
||||
"karma-jasmine": "~5.1.0",
|
||||
"karma-jasmine-html-reporter": "~2.1.0",
|
||||
"typescript": "~5.4.2"
|
||||
"typescript": "~5.8.3"
|
||||
}
|
||||
}
|
||||
|
||||
@@ -1,5 +1,5 @@
|
||||
import { APP_BASE_HREF } from '@angular/common';
|
||||
import { CommonEngine } from '@angular/ssr';
|
||||
import { CommonEngine } from '@angular/ssr/node';
|
||||
import express from 'express';
|
||||
import { fileURLToPath } from 'node:url';
|
||||
import { dirname, join, resolve } from 'node:path';
|
||||
|
||||
@@ -12,7 +12,6 @@ import {TournamentService} from "./service/tournament.service";
|
||||
|
||||
@Component({
|
||||
selector: 'app-root',
|
||||
standalone: true,
|
||||
imports: [RouterOutlet, CommonModule, RouterLink, RouterLinkActive, MatAnchor, MatIcon, MatButton, MatToolbar, NgOptimizedImage, MatIconButton, MatMiniFabButton, MatMenuTrigger, MatMenu, MatMenuItem],
|
||||
providers: [TitleService],
|
||||
templateUrl: './app.component.html',
|
||||
|
||||
@@ -12,7 +12,6 @@ import {MatButton} from "@angular/material/button";
|
||||
|
||||
@Component({
|
||||
selector: 'app-court-selection',
|
||||
standalone: true,
|
||||
imports: [
|
||||
MatDialogTitle,
|
||||
MatDialogContent,
|
||||
|
||||
@@ -16,7 +16,6 @@ import {TitleService} from "../../service/title.service";
|
||||
@Component({
|
||||
selector: 'app-login',
|
||||
templateUrl: './login.component.html',
|
||||
standalone: true,
|
||||
imports: [
|
||||
MatCardTitle,
|
||||
MatCardContent,
|
||||
|
||||
@@ -22,7 +22,6 @@ import {Game} from "../../model/game";
|
||||
|
||||
@Component({
|
||||
selector: 'app-match-result',
|
||||
standalone: true,
|
||||
imports: [
|
||||
MatDialogContent,
|
||||
MatDialogActions,
|
||||
|
||||
@@ -15,7 +15,6 @@ import {TitleService} from "../../service/title.service";
|
||||
|
||||
@Component({
|
||||
selector: 'app-match-sheets',
|
||||
standalone: true,
|
||||
imports: [
|
||||
MatCard,
|
||||
MatCardHeader,
|
||||
|
||||
@@ -18,7 +18,6 @@ import {NgxMaskDirective, NgxMaskPipe} from "ngx-mask";
|
||||
|
||||
@Component({
|
||||
selector: 'app-player-edit',
|
||||
standalone: true,
|
||||
imports: [
|
||||
FormsModule,
|
||||
RouterLink,
|
||||
|
||||
@@ -4,7 +4,6 @@ import {RouterLink} from "@angular/router";
|
||||
|
||||
@Component({
|
||||
selector: 'player-link',
|
||||
standalone: true,
|
||||
imports: [
|
||||
MatAnchor,
|
||||
RouterLink
|
||||
|
||||
@@ -24,7 +24,6 @@ import {MatSort, MatSortHeader} from "@angular/material/sort";
|
||||
|
||||
@Component({
|
||||
selector: 'app-player-list',
|
||||
standalone: true,
|
||||
imports: [NgFor, RouterLink, MatAnchor, MatIcon, MatCard, MatCardHeader, MatCardContent, FullNamePipe, MatTable, MatColumnDef, MatHeaderCell, MatHeaderCellDef, MatCell, MatCellDef, MatHeaderRow, MatHeaderRowDef, MatRow, MatRowDef, MatFormField, MatInput, MatFormFieldModule, MatPaginator, MatSortHeader, MatSort],
|
||||
providers: [FullNamePipe],
|
||||
templateUrl: './player-list.component.html',
|
||||
|
||||
@@ -21,7 +21,6 @@ import {TitleService} from "../../service/title.service";
|
||||
|
||||
@Component({
|
||||
selector: 'app-player-registrations',
|
||||
standalone: true,
|
||||
imports: [
|
||||
MatCard,
|
||||
MatCardContent,
|
||||
|
||||
@@ -15,7 +15,6 @@ import {TitleService} from "../../service/title.service";
|
||||
|
||||
@Component({
|
||||
selector: 'app-round-overview',
|
||||
standalone: true,
|
||||
imports: [
|
||||
NgForOf,
|
||||
TeamPipe,
|
||||
|
||||
@@ -18,7 +18,6 @@ import {FullNamePipe} from "../../pipes/fullname-pipe";
|
||||
|
||||
@Component({
|
||||
selector: 'app-tournament-divide',
|
||||
standalone: true,
|
||||
imports: [
|
||||
MatCard,
|
||||
MatCardHeader,
|
||||
|
||||
@@ -16,7 +16,6 @@ import {FullNamePipe} from "../../pipes/fullname-pipe";
|
||||
|
||||
@Component({
|
||||
selector: 'app-tournament-draw',
|
||||
standalone: true,
|
||||
imports: [
|
||||
FullNamePipe,
|
||||
MatCard,
|
||||
|
||||
@@ -19,7 +19,6 @@ registerLocaleData(nl);
|
||||
|
||||
@Component({
|
||||
selector: 'app-tournament-edit',
|
||||
standalone: true,
|
||||
imports: [
|
||||
FormsModule,
|
||||
RouterLink,
|
||||
|
||||
@@ -20,7 +20,6 @@ import {TitleService} from "../../service/title.service";
|
||||
|
||||
@Component({
|
||||
selector: 'app-tournament-list',
|
||||
standalone: true,
|
||||
imports: [
|
||||
NgFor, RouterLink, NgIf, MatAnchor, MatIcon, MatCard, MatCardHeader, MatCardContent, MatButton, MatTable, MatColumnDef, MatHeaderCell, MatHeaderCellDef, MatCell, MatCellDef, MatHeaderRow, MatRow, MatTableModule, MatIconButton, MatMenuTrigger
|
||||
],
|
||||
|
||||
@@ -35,7 +35,6 @@ import {TitleService} from "../../service/title.service";
|
||||
|
||||
@Component({
|
||||
selector: 'app-tournament-manage',
|
||||
standalone: true,
|
||||
imports: [
|
||||
FullNamePipe,
|
||||
MatAccordion,
|
||||
|
||||
@@ -11,7 +11,6 @@ import {TitleService} from "../../service/title.service";
|
||||
|
||||
@Component({
|
||||
selector: 'app-tournament-registrations',
|
||||
standalone: true,
|
||||
imports: [
|
||||
MatCard,
|
||||
MatCardHeader,
|
||||
|
||||
@@ -20,7 +20,6 @@ import {PlayerLinkComponent} from "../player-link/player-link.component";
|
||||
|
||||
@Component({
|
||||
selector: 'app-tournament-validate',
|
||||
standalone: true,
|
||||
imports: [
|
||||
MatCard,
|
||||
MatCardHeader,
|
||||
|
||||
Reference in New Issue
Block a user